Your Home from Home
Green Pastures Christian Nursing home is a not for profit nursing home on the doorstep of the Cotswolds in Oxfordshire. The dedicated and experienced team offers specialist 24-hour nursing as well as palliative and dementia care. They love to see residents fulfilling lives, as part of a community marked by kindness, respect and humour.

Dementia Care TypesMild Dementia
Someone living with our definition of "mild dementia" might experience some or all of the following:
- Memory problems such as misplacing items and not be able to recall recent events (however, in some forms of dementia a person's memory may be unchanged)
- Difficulties thinking through problems and planning, making decisions
- Language and communication issues such as finding it difficult to recall the appropriate word in a conversation or following a conversation
- Poor orientation, getting lost in areas previously familiar to them
- Difficulty judging distances (more falls than usual)
- Changes in their normal mood including anxiety and depression
- In certain types of dementia, personality and behaviour changes may be present alongside or instead of issues with memory or concentration.
Moderate Dementia
Someone living with our definition of "moderate dementia" might experience some or all of the following:
- Worsened memory problems. Not always recognising own family members and friends. Repeating the same questions over and over again
- Worsened language and communication issues, forgetting what they are saying mid-sentence. Not being able to understand what someone else is saying
- More frequent confusion, e.g. about the time of day or where they are, including their own home
- Apathy, depression and anxiety
- Believing things that aren't true (paranoia)
- Frequent hallucinations
- Lack of emotional control, quick to anger, fearfulness, sadness
- Loss of inhibition
- Difficulties sleeping or waking during the night and behaving as though it is daytime - loss of circadian rhythm.
Advanced Dementia
Someone living with our definition of "severe dementia" might experience some or all of the following:
- Severe memory problems. Not recognising family members and friends. Not being able to recall their own name
- Severe language and communication issues, not being able to understand what someone else is saying
- Severe confusion, e.g. about the time of day or where they are, including their own home
- Apathy, depression and anxiety
- Believing things that aren't true (paranoia)
- Frequent hallucinations
- Lack of emotional control, quick to anger, fearfulness, sadness
- Loss of inhibition
- Difficulties sleeping or waking during the night and behaving as though it is daytime - loss of circadian rhythm.
Verbally or physically aggressive behaviour
If your loved one displays this type of behaviour you may need a care home that has specially trained staff. Verbal/physical aggression is often defined:
- Consistent shouting and screaming
- Verbal abuse
- Physical abuse

I have been a resident of Green Pastures since Nov 2024, my late wife was a resident in 2018, my experience therefore, has been very favourable. My physical infirmity certainly required 'in house' treatment and this has been very good. I feel my life has taken on a new dimension and the daily activities and care has enabled me to feel part of a definite community. I have particularly enjoyed the 'in house' activities, particularly the musical entertainment. The food has been good, but it would be good to have some input into the types of food. The garden is a real bonus, and the Garden Group is very enjoyable, as is the Life History Group. Church activities are mainly of an Evangelist Christian variety, whilst I am an Anglican (Liberal Catholic) and so not always to my taste - but I find the chaplains very supportive.

My brother was transferred to Green Pastures from hospital in Staffordshire, where he had been for 10 months and had developed complex additional needs. From the outset, staff at Green Pastures demonstrated an understanding of the trauma he had experienced and took time to connect with him. They did everything to make him comfortable and feel cared for. We both received a really warm and genuine welcome. My brother began to improve immediately and began attempts at communication, after months of total disengagement. I was able to bring treasured possessions into the room which further prompted his attempts to speak. It was fantastic to visit and see him clean shaven and dressed in one of his favourite t shirts. Staff took time to find out more about him and I knew that they had really listened when I visited and found him listening to his music or found him in the lounge with other residents. Such level of care and dedication is so valuable to both of us. Thank you.

My dad had Alzheimers so sometimes he could be challenging. He absolutely loved it here, he loved the people and the activities and days out, he really came out of himself so much more with people around him. We sang, we placed instruments, games. He went on trips. Not only do they care for the person medically and physically but also and so importantly through their wellbeing too. They take the time and trouble to get to know the residents and their families to understand the person.
I will never be able to thank them enough for their dedication and how they looked after my Dad. I highly recommend Green Pastures Christian Nursing Home.

Inspection ratings
We rate most services according to how safe, effective, caring, responsive and well-led they are, using four levels:
- Outstanding - The service is performing exceptionally well.
- Good - The service is performing well and meeting our expectations.
- Requires Improvement - The service isn't performing as well as it should and we have told the service how it must improve.
- Inadequate - The service is performing badly and we've taken action against the person or organisation that runs it.
- Not rated - we have not yet rated this area of the service, this is normally because the assessments we have carried out have been focused on other key questions.
